**Action Item PM-31: Localize date formats**

During the Larkspur outage, hardcoded month-day ordering confused operators in two regions and delayed triage. All dashboards must now render dates via the shared locale helper. New team members: audit your components for raw format strings before next sprint. The helper's usage guide is on the internal page below.

runbook for badug-kadup: https://confluence.zemvarlabs.internal/projects/browse/display/projects/bd1b

## Bakery Cutoff Rule — Who Owns What

Quick heads up for future maintainers: the Ovenline order-cutoff rule (no custom cake orders after 2pm for next-day pickup) lives in the pricing-rules service, not the storefront. Yes, that's weird; no, don't move it without talking to ops first. Holiday overrides are a config flag, refreshed each season. If the cutoff misfires or a store needs an exception, ping the rules team at this inbox.

escalation mailbox, yafog-kafof: eliok@xolmarcloud.local

// NIGHTLY_REINDEX_WINDOW_HOURS
// Heads up, reviewer: this constant gates the Tallowfen search reindex.
// The job runs with elevated read access to the Murkside document store,
// so keep the window tight — longer windows mean a longer exposure
// surface for those temp credentials. We rotate the service key right
// after each run, promise. If you're auditing a specific run, match it
// against the trace token stamped below.

pipeline stamp: htk21_0e1a1ddcdb5bfd88d6dd6